The relationship between the intake of fruits, vegetables, and dairy products with hypertension: findings from the STEPS study.

Mehran NouriMarzieh MahmoodiMohebat ValiMehran Nouri
Published in: BMC nutrition (2023)
Our study showed that increasing fruit consumption was related to reducing hypertension odds. Regarding the consumption of dairy products and vegetables, no significant relationship was found with the odds of hypertension. More studies, especially cohorts, are needed to evaluate the impacts of FV and dairy products on the risk of hypertension.
